This war left Britain with a lot of debt and was a major factor in starting the American Revolution.
What was The French and Indian War?
He was the primary author of the Declaration of Independence.
Who is Thomas Jefferson?
Thomas Paine wrote this famous document to argue for independence from the British King.
What is Common Sense?
George Washington and his troops crossed this river to attack Hessian mercenaries during a winter battle
What was the Delaware River (Battle of Trenton)?
This group of women focused on helping colonists boycott British goods.
The Daughters of Liberty
This 1763 rule prohibited colonial settlers from moving west of the Appalachian Mountains
What was The Proclamation of 1763?
This Prussian officer helped George Washington by training his soldiers at Valley Forge.
Who is Baron von Steuben?
This document was written to announce to the world why the colonies were separating from England
What is the Declaration of Independence?
This battle is known for convincing the French to enter the war to help the Americans.
What was the Battle of Saratoga?
This religious movement challenged traditional authority and helped form the basis of revolutionary enthusiasm.
What was The Great Awakening?
These "Acts" closed the Boston Harbor and took away the power of colonists to govern themselves.
What was The Coercive (Intolerable) Acts?
This American diplomat secured France as an ally during the Revolutionary War.
Who is Benjamin Franklin?
This philosopher’s ideas on "natural rights" and "social contract" influenced the writing of the Declaration of Independence.
Who is John Locke?
At this battle, geography played a role as the British were cut off from supplies and forced to surrender
The Battle of Yorktown
This British policy of "neglect" actually allowed American colonists to govern themselves for a long time
What was Salutary Neglect?
This act of British Parliament charged a tax on all paper documents in the colonies.
What was The Stamp Act?
This group first formed with the goal of protesting unfair taxes imposed by the British.
Who are the Sons of Liberty?
Colonial leaders formed these committees to share information and coordinate actions against Great Britain.
What was Committees of Correspondence?
Washington used this harsh winter encampment to train his raw recruits into a professional army.
What was Valley Forge?
Many free African Americans joined the Patriot side because they hoped to gain this in the new nation
What was Freedom?
This economic system meant that colonies supplied raw materials to Europe for trade.
What was Mercantilism?
This specific group of people was given the task of drafting the Declaration of Independence.
What was the Committee of Five?
According to the Declaration of Independence, the power to govern comes from this group
Who are The People?
This 1783 treaty officially ended the American Revolution and set the U.S. border at the Mississippi River.
What was the Treaty of Paris 1783?
These were three common roles for women who worked in Revolutionary War army camps.
What were Cooks, Nurses, and Spies
